Output 86ef4dbdf63259fe1aa2fc87159159100ea1eca7e65b1b7811bf96ef4a5de71e:2

value
73123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15009afb10fca9415377a565a59f62a6e167511e OP_EQUAL
address
33c4qdpeABTh13L1vZrDA6dpw9RZE7eQ6g
transaction
86ef4dbdf63259fe1aa2fc87159159100ea1eca7e65b1b7811bf96ef4a5de71e
confirmations
281071
spent
true